TABLE 1.

Optical data (absorption and fluorescence maxima, Stokes shift, and absolute fluorescence quantum yield (Φ F)) of D1 and D2 systems in solvents with a decreasing dielectric constant (ε) under anaerobic conditions. Fluorescence and Φ F measurements were recorded upon excitation at 365 nm.

Sample Solvent, dielectric constant (ε) Abs. max., λ abs (nm) Fluor. max., λ em (nm) Stokes shift, Δλ (nm) Φ F (%) Nature of the solvent
D1 Dimethylsulfoxide (DMSO, ε = 46.7) 265 and 376 410, 436, and 609 233 16 Polar aprotic
Acetonitrile (ACN, ε = 37.5) 260 and 349 418 and 593 244 19
Dimethylformamide (DMF, ε = 36.7) 265 and 373 410, 438, and 588 215 29
Methanol (MeOH, ε = 32.7) 260 and 361 410, 445, and 608 247 2 Polar protic
Ethanol (EtOH, ε = 24.5) 261 and 364 410 and 595 231 7
Dichloromethane (DCM, ε = 8.9) 261 and 369 525 156 82 Medium polar
Ethyl acetate (AcOEt, ε = 6.0) 261 and 362 514 152 54
Chloroform (CHCl3, ε = 4.8) 262 and 365 497 132 41
Toluene (Tol, ε = 2.4) 286 and 365 452 87 87 Non-polar
Benzene (Bz, ε = 2.3) 278 and 365 455 90 96
Hexane (Hx, ε = 1.9) 259 and 354 403, 425, and 454 49 87
D2 Dimethylsulfoxide (DMSO, ε = 46.7) 287, 307, and 374 411 and 574 200 79 Polar aprotic
Acetonitrile (ACN, ε = 37.5) 265, 303, and 365 411 and 574 209 78
Dimethylformamide (DMF, ε = 36.7) 279, 306, and 372 411 and 559 187 87
Methanol (MeOH, ε = 32.7) 265, 304, and 365 411, 447, and 600 235 3 Polar protic
Ethanol (EtOH, ε = 24.5) 268, 305, and 367 411 and 571 204 31
Dichloromethane (DCM, ε = 8.9) 269, 307, and 371 520 149 91 Medium polar
Ethyl acetate (AcOEt, ε = 6.0) 257, 304, and 366 493 127 82
Chloroform (CHCl3, ε = 4.8) 266, 308, and 372 493 121 84
Toluene (Tol, ε = 2.4) 286, 306, and 373 444 71 96 Non-polar
Benzene (Bz, ε = 2.3) 287, 307, and 371 445 74 69
Hexane (Hx, ε = 1.9) 267, 303, and 366 411, 434, and 465 45 75
